NOW TESTAMENT: Central Church's Ministry to Youth

The NOW Testament is not just another set of programs to
keep students engaged and entertained. We strongly
believe in ministry with the students, not at them.
The story behind the name is simple. We are all familiar
with the Old and New Testaments of God’s Word. But what
about NOW? Have you discovered your part in God’s story?
That’s our heartbeat, helping students discover God’s
amazing story and see His plan for how they fit into it.

9:15 a.m. is time set aside for Bible Fellowship
Class. Classes are available for Junior High
students, (7th & 8th grade) and Senior High
Students (9th-12th grade). Both classes meet upstairs
in the youth area.
House
Church
starts at 5:00 p.m. and brings church home! Students
meet with their peers at the Youth Pastor’s home near
the church. Sponsors lead outreach, teaching and
prayer utilizing multiple media options. All students
gather afterwards at a pre-determined restaurant to
eat and hang out. Everyone returns to the church by
8:00 p.m. for parent pick up. Every time there is a
5th Sunday in a month, we forego House Church and
spend the afternoon in service either to a church
member or to the community.
From 7:00-8:15 p.m. is our Wednesday night service
called Rhythm. The evening is designed to give
students a chance to get to know one another, be
involved in praise and worship, serve in some
capacity in youth ministry and have a lot of fun!
Doors open at 6 for early arrivers and pick up is
expected by 9:00 p.m. From 6:00-7:00 p.m., our drama
troupe refines their acting skills and rehearsing
skits for various audiences.
The NOW Testament mans the coffee bar “Kaffee Shoppe”
located in the atrium of the Family Life Center.
Please stop by any Sunday morning or Wednesday
evening and support the youth ministry. Students earn
income from the profit of the coffee bar and apply it
to the youth group trip of their choice.
Students have pretty full calendars these days.
Being mindful of that, our top priority is
prayerfully scheduling events that will have a
lasting impact. Below are our major annual events.
Mpact Crew
A short term, usually 1 week, trip to enable students
to encounter life outside the norm.
Oxygen
Week
Not
your typical summer camp experience, but more like a
youth conference where students can choose tracks
emphasizing their gifts and interests. Worship, fun,
relationships and learning are the focal points of
Oxygen Week.
District
Fall Retreat
An
annual favorite long weekend bringing students from
across the Northeast district together. This event is
held in Northeast Oklahoma in November.
Ignition
A new addition to our list! Ignition is a full
weekend of events geared to help students get into
focus for the new year. Awesome speakers, worship,
prizes and games start the year off right.
Thrill
Seekers Week
A Spring Break guaranteed to re-energize school
soaked students! Whether on the slopes or on the
beach, Spring Break with a spiritual twist meets the
needs of weary students.
Resident
Alien Resident
Since Area 51 is off base for most of us, we take the
students for a long weekend of reflection mixed with
friendship and fun.
Naz
Nite
A fast paced trip to Six Flags Over Texas in Ft.
Worth, where students and families from all over our
region basically take over Six Flags on the Friday
before Labor Day.
Extravaganza
Display your gifts and talents at this annual
regional event for students in grades 7-12. Friends
from several states gather at SNU in Bethany,
Oklahoma, to compete academically, in the arts and on
the field. Extravaganza is held each Spring. These
events, coupled with concerts, impromptu
get-togethers, a few cool fundraisers and our weekly
services help give students a place for friendship
and growth in Christ.
